‘Unbelievable’ support from home fans fuelling Canada’s run at FIFA World Cup
VANCOUVER — Derek Cornelius used to be able to walk down Canadian streets in relative anonymity.
Not anymore.
Canada’s run at this summer’s FIFA World Cup has shone a bright new light on many of the national squad’s players, and they say that support is helping to fuel their success.
“I think for a lot of the guys, maybe when we’re playing on our European teams, when you go out on the street, you could maybe get recognized and asked for pictures and autographs, but not so much in Canada,” Cornelius said ahead of training on Sunday.
